An update from Serica Energy ( (GB:SQZ) ) is now available.
Serica Energy has announced a temporary suspension of production at the Triton FPSO due to an issue with the flare system, which is expected to result in production levels falling below the previously guided range of 29,000 to 32,000 boepd. The company is engaging with the operator to address the issue and improve performance, aiming to align production levels with the subsurface potential. This situation highlights operational challenges for Serica, impacting its production forecasts and potentially affecting stakeholder confidence.

More about Serica Energy
Serica Energy is a British independent oil and gas exploration and production company with a portfolio of UK Continental Shelf (UKCS) assets. The company is responsible for about 5% of the natural gas produced in the UK, contributing significantly to the UK’s energy transition. Serica’s operations are centered around the Bruce, Keith, and Rhum fields in the UK Northern North Sea, and a mix of operated and non-operated fields tied back to the Triton FPSO. The company also has interests in the Columbus and Orlando fields in the UK Central and Northern North Sea, respectively, and a non-operated interest in the Erskine field.
